Kind of a similar system here in Canada. Generally you don't qualify for unemployment if you are fired, but you are asked to give the details surrounding your termination and it is handled on a case by case basis. Interestingly enough, as I understand it, the former employer is almost never brought into the situation and the decision is left up to the agent assigned to your claim.
